在现代快节奏的生活中,碎片时间无处不在——通勤路上、排队等候、午休间隙,甚至是在等待会议开始的几分钟。这些看似微不足道的时间片段,如果能够被有效利用,将对个人学习和成长产生巨大的推动作用。然而,许多人却常常陷入拖延症的泥潭,让这些宝贵的时间白白流逝。本文将详细探讨如何高效利用碎片时间提升学习效率,并有效避免拖延症的困扰。我们将从理解碎片时间、识别拖延根源、制定高效策略、利用工具辅助以及培养良好习惯等多个方面展开,结合具体案例和实用方法,帮助你将碎片时间转化为学习的黄金时段。

一、理解碎片时间:从“无用”到“高效”的转变

碎片时间通常指那些短暂、不连续且难以用于深度工作的时段。例如,通勤时间(通常为15-30分钟)、排队等待(5-10分钟)、午休前后的间隙(10-15分钟)等。这些时间往往被人们忽视,认为它们不足以完成任何有意义的任务。然而,研究表明,每天积累的碎片时间总和可能达到1-2小时,如果能够合理利用,一年下来就是数百小时的学习机会。

1.1 碎片时间的分类与特点

  • 通勤时间:通常较长且规律,适合进行听力学习或阅读。
  • 等待时间:短暂且不确定,适合进行快速复习或记忆练习。
  • 休息间隙:介于工作或学习任务之间,适合进行放松性学习或思维整理。

1.2 碎片时间的价值

以一位职场人士为例,假设他每天通勤时间为30分钟(往返),午休前后有15分钟,排队等待平均10分钟,总计每天约55分钟。如果将这些时间用于学习英语单词,每天学习10个单词,一年下来就是3650个单词,相当于掌握了中级英语词汇量。这就是碎片时间的累积效应。

二、识别拖延症的根源:为什么我们总是拖延?

拖延症并非简单的懒惰,而是由多种心理和环境因素共同作用的结果。常见的根源包括:

2.1 任务恐惧

对任务的难度或不确定性感到恐惧,导致逃避行为。例如,学习一门新编程语言时,面对复杂的语法和概念,容易产生畏难情绪。

2.2 完美主义

追求完美导致迟迟无法开始,因为总觉得准备不足。例如,想写一篇技术博客,却因为担心内容不够全面而迟迟不动笔。

2.3 缺乏明确目标

没有清晰的学习目标,导致动力不足。例如,想提升数据分析能力,但没有具体的学习路径,容易陷入盲目学习。

2.4 环境干扰

手机通知、社交媒体等外部干扰分散注意力。例如,计划用碎片时间学习,却不断被微信消息打断。

2.5 即时满足偏好

大脑更倾向于选择即时娱乐(如刷短视频)而非长期收益的学习。例如,午休时本想看技术文章,却忍不住打开了抖音。

三、高效利用碎片时间的策略:从计划到执行

3.1 制定碎片时间学习计划

首先,需要识别并记录自己的碎片时间。可以使用时间追踪工具(如Toggl或RescueTime)记录一周的时间分配,找出可利用的碎片时段。

案例:小王是一名程序员,通过一周的记录发现,他每天有以下碎片时间:

  • 通勤:40分钟(地铁上)
  • 午休前:15分钟
  • 下午茶时间:10分钟
  • 下班后等待公交:10分钟

总计每天约75分钟。他决定将这些时间用于学习新技术,如Python数据分析。

3.2 选择适合碎片时间的学习内容

碎片时间不适合深度思考或复杂操作,但非常适合以下内容:

  • 记忆类:单词、公式、概念。
  • 听力类:播客、有声书、课程录音。
  • 阅读类:短篇文章、技术博客、新闻。
  • 复习类:回顾笔记、整理思维导图。

案例:小王将通勤时间用于听Python数据分析的播客(如“Python数据科学入门”),午休前阅读技术博客(如“Towards Data Science”),下午茶时间复习前一天学习的代码片段。

3.3 使用“微任务”分解法

将大任务分解为可在5-10分钟内完成的微任务。例如,学习Python数据分析可以分解为:

  • 微任务1:理解Pandas的基本数据结构(5分钟)
  • 微任务2:练习读取CSV文件(5分钟)
  • 微任务3:学习数据清洗的常用方法(10分钟)

代码示例:以下是一个简单的Python代码示例,用于在碎片时间练习数据清洗。你可以在等待时间打开手机上的Python编辑器(如Pydroid)运行这段代码。

import pandas as pd

# 创建一个简单的DataFrame
data = {
    'Name': ['Alice', 'Bob', 'Charlie', None],
    'Age': [25, 30, None, 35],
    'City': ['New York', 'London', 'Paris', 'Tokyo']
}
df = pd.DataFrame(data)

# 微任务:处理缺失值
print("原始数据:")
print(df)

# 填充缺失值
df['Name'].fillna('Unknown', inplace=True)
df['Age'].fillna(df['Age'].mean(), inplace=True)

print("\n处理后的数据:")
print(df)

这段代码可以在5分钟内完成,适合碎片时间练习。

3.4 利用工具辅助学习

选择适合碎片时间的学习工具:

  • 移动学习App:如Duolingo(语言学习)、Anki(记忆卡片)、Coursera(课程视频)。
  • 阅读工具:如Pocket(保存文章离线阅读)、Feedly(订阅技术博客)。
  • 笔记工具:如Notion、Evernote,用于快速记录灵感或复习要点。

案例:小王使用Anki创建Python函数的记忆卡片,每天在通勤时间复习5-10张卡片。Anki的间隔重复算法能有效巩固记忆。

四、克服拖延症:从心理到行动的转变

4.1 设定明确的目标和奖励

使用SMART原则设定目标:具体(Specific)、可衡量(Measurable)、可实现(Achievable)、相关(Relevant)、有时限(Time-bound)。

案例:小王设定目标:“在两周内,通过每天30分钟的碎片时间学习,掌握Pandas的基本操作,并完成一个小型数据分析项目。”他为自己设定了奖励:完成目标后,购买一本心仪的技术书籍。

4.2 采用“两分钟法则”

如果一项任务可以在两分钟内完成,立即执行。对于碎片时间学习,可以先从简单的任务开始,降低启动阻力。

案例:小王在午休前打开Anki,复习5张卡片(约2分钟),这让他更容易进入学习状态,从而可能延长学习时间。

4.3 创建无干扰环境

在碎片时间学习时,尽量减少干扰。例如:

  • 将手机调至静音或使用专注模式(如Forest App)。
  • 提前下载好学习材料,避免在线搜索分心。

案例:小王在通勤前将播客下载到手机,避免网络不稳定导致中断。他使用“勿扰模式”屏蔽通知,确保专注学习。

4.4 利用“习惯叠加”法

将新习惯与已有习惯绑定。例如:“每次刷牙后,我会花5分钟复习Anki卡片。”这样更容易形成规律。

案例:小王将“午休前阅读技术博客”与“午饭后”这个已有习惯绑定,形成条件反射。

五、长期坚持:培养可持续的学习习惯

5.1 定期回顾与调整

每周回顾碎片时间的利用情况,调整学习计划。例如,如果发现通勤时间学习效果不佳,可以尝试更换内容(如从播客改为阅读)。

案例:小王每周日花10分钟回顾本周的学习记录,发现下午茶时间容易被工作打断,于是调整为将下午茶时间用于更灵活的任务(如整理笔记)。

5.2 加入学习社群

与志同道合的人一起学习,可以增加动力和 accountability。例如,加入Python学习群,每天分享学习心得。

案例:小王加入了一个Python数据分析的微信群,每天在群里打卡学习进度,这让他更有动力坚持。

5.3 保持灵活性

碎片时间学习不应成为负担。如果某天状态不佳,可以适当减少任务量,避免产生抵触情绪。

案例:小王在疲惫时,将通勤时间的学习内容从播客改为轻松的音乐,保持学习习惯的同时不增加压力。

六、总结:将碎片时间转化为成长的阶梯

高效利用碎片时间提升学习效率并避免拖延症,关键在于:

  1. 识别并规划:明确自己的碎片时间,制定针对性的学习计划。
  2. 选择合适内容:根据时间长度和场景选择记忆、听力、阅读等微任务。
  3. 克服拖延:通过目标设定、两分钟法则、环境优化等方法减少启动阻力。
  4. 工具辅助:利用移动App和工具提升学习效率。
  5. 长期坚持:通过回顾、社群和灵活性保持习惯的可持续性。

通过以上方法,你可以将原本被浪费的碎片时间转化为高效学习的黄金时段,逐步克服拖延症,实现个人能力的持续提升。记住,学习是一场马拉松,而碎片时间就是沿途的补给站——合理利用,你将跑得更远、更稳。